An Ultrasensitive Luciferase Reporter Reveals Low-Level Extrahepatic mRNA Expression for Enhanced Apparent Biodistribution of Lipid Nanoparticles
Reporter mRNAs are widely used to screen lipid nanoparticle (LNP) formulations and characterize functional mRNA expression in vivo, yet conventional firefly luciferase (FLuc) imaging fails to detect low-level expression.
